Top 5 Most Comfortable Couches For Sale
There are numerous things to think about when shopping for a new sofa. The style, the fabric as well as comfort level and price are a few of the most important considerations.
Another thing to consider is whether the sofa can be inserted through doors and stairways. It's always an excellent idea to measure your space prior to buying any furniture of a large size.

Inside Weather Bondi Sofa
The Bondi Sofa is an adaptable modular couch. It can be rearranged to suit your needs. It is available in a variety of configurations and is sleek in design. This sofa is a great option for those who want to change their decor frequently or have guests over often. The sofa can be customized with a wide range of styles and colors. It also comes with a moveable chaise that can be affixed to any seat. The Bondi Sofa is made from hardwood frames and has elastic webbing for support.
The hardwood frame of the Bondi Sofa is sustainably sourced and offers eco-friendly advantages. The elastic webbing is designed to draw water away and stop the growth of mold and mildew. The cushions are filled with a mix of fiber and foam. The foam is made of recycled materials. Fabric is durable and easy-to-clean. The Bondi Sofa is available in various colors and fabrics, including Mod Velvet, Indigo Microfiber Honey Luxury Velvet and Dijon Linen Weave.
Inside Weather offers a 365 day trial period on all of their couches and has a team of experts dedicated to customer service. The company provides free swatches of all their fabrics.

Maiden Home Warren Sofa
The Warren Sofa from Maiden Home is the best sofa for relaxation since it's comfortable, well-made and priced at a reasonable price. It features a solid wood frame and high-resiliency foam cushions that have fiber padding wrap that gives a plush sit. The fabric is a high-performance weave made from upcycled materials and can withstand wear and tear. The brand offers a free consultation to anyone who wants to discuss various fabrics as well as seat depths and sizes prior to purchasing the product.
The company is committed to supplying high-quality furniture at affordable prices. It is in direct contact with the artisans of North Carolina, cutting out the middlemen who typically add to furniture prices (showrooms wholesalers and boutiques). The result is a couch that feels expensive and luxurious however, it is much cheaper than options available at big-box retailers or designer boutiques.
We tried the sofa in a charcoal twill material that appeared thick and durable, and it has stood up to everyday use quite well so far. The removable cushion covers make it easy to clean, and the frame is strong enough to keep the back cushions from sliding. The only downside is that it's a challenge to put together without help or a toolkit.
Other benefits include a customizable comfort profile as well as a range of lengths and upholstery colors. The company offers white glove delivery in which a team will bring the sofa to your home and set it in the space that you want, then take away all packaging.

Floyd Sofa
As humans spend [insert an extremely large number of] hours per week on couches, it's crucial to have one that provides both comfort and function. This doesn't mean that a futon with Ketchup packets hunkering in the corners but it also doesn't necessarily equate to a leather sectional that costs $6,000.
Detroit's furniture wizards Floyd are the answer. They've already made an impression with stripped-back desks and platform beds, but their new sofa is the one that is grabbing our focus. The three-seater sofa is a sleek contemporary piece with a timeless birch frame and powder-coated steel legs. The upholstery, made of oat twill, is both durable and versatile and comes in a variety of neutral colors that blend well with almost any style of decor.
It's a direct-to-consumer item that means it comes in boxes (four for the smaller models of two and three seats The larger model with chaise comes in seven or eight). Floyd promises an easy assembly process, with clear instructions that children can follow. In our tests the pieces were well put together and snugly and the set-up process took just an hour. The amount of boxes available is a problem for eco-conscious consumers, in particular because there's plenty of packaging left behind.
The modular design of the Floyd Sofa allows it to be easily reconfigured and expanded to meet various seating requirements and spaces. The company offers a buy-back service which allows customers to return any of their products. They will be sent to the fulfillment center of Floyd where they will be examined and then offered for sale.
While it's still early days for this type of business model, we believe it could reduce the amount of trash sofa sale in our communities and homes while providing a better experience for buyers. We'll keep an eye on it as it grows.
